How the National League table looked 10 years ago

We continue our look at who sat where in the National League table 10 years ago…

19) GATESHEAD

This time 10 years ago: Played: 21 Points: 22
Their final position in the 2009/10 season: 20th (Played: 44 – Points: 45)
The manager they ended with: Ian Bogie
The club’s top scorer, League: Daryl Clare (15)

 

18) TAMWORTH

This time 10 years ago: Played: 21 Points: 23
Their final position in the 2009/10 season: 16th (Played: 44 – Points: 49)
The manager they ended with: Gary Mills
The club’s top scorer, League: Bradley Pritchard (7)

17) HAYES & YEADING

This time 10 years ago: Played: 22 Points: 24
Their final position in the 2009/10 season: 17th (Played: 44 – Points: 48)
The manager they ended with: Garry Haylock
The club’s top scorer, League: Scott Fitzgerald (11)

 

16) CAMBRIDGE UNITED

This time 10 years ago: Played: 21 Points: 27
Their final position in the 2009/10 season: 10th (Played: 44 – Points: 59)
The manager they ended with: Martin Ling
The club’s top scorer, League: Danny Crow (19)
